Koch Engineered Solutions (KES) is seeking a Master Data Management (MDM)
Architect to join our global Information Technology (IT) capability in Wichita, KS.

In this role, you will partner with KES IT and business teams to design, implement, and scale enterprise MDM capabilities across key KES data domains. You will work closely with Data Architects, Data Leads, Data Analysts, and Data Owners to establish appropriate guardrails and frameworks as we mature our single source of truth (SSOT) data governance across business domains.

We are looking for someone who is proactive, contribution-motivated, and passionate about building scalable data foundations, reusable patterns, and enterprise standards.

What You Will Do
  • Design, build, and establish policies, standards, and procedures governing master data across business functions in defined data domains.
  • Work collaboratively with enterprise MDM teams to facilitate data harmonization efforts across divisions
  • Define and monitor key data quality KPIs and performance metrics.
  • Define business logic, implement survivorship criteria, and develop match & merge rules to define clean, accurate golden records.
  • Develop integration patterns from MDM platform into upstream and downstream systems
  • Work closely with the enterprise data platform team (Snowflake) and analytics team
  • Lead root cause analysis and remediation of recurring data issues.
  • Implement preventative controls to improve data accuracy and consistency.
  • Develop reporting and dashboards measuring data quality performance
  • Mature the KES data foundation by identifying gaps in data coverage, quality, lineage, and structure, then prioritizing improvements through an iterative, product-minded approach.
